Sparta Prague aims to sign midfielder Roman Macek

Roman Macek, a 29‑year‑old Czech midfielder who began his career in the Juventus youth system and later had spells at Arsenal, Manchester United, Lugano and Mladá Boleslav, is the target of Sparta Prague. The club is reportedly close to activating a release clause in Macek’s contract, valued at roughly 15 million Czech crowns, to bolster a midfield lacking creative options.

Sparta’s sporting director Tomáš Rosický confirmed the interest, noting that the team also faces injuries to key midfielders such as Patrik Vydra and Magnus Kofod Andersen. The move would give Sparta a player who once met Cristiano Ronaldo during his time at Juventus and could help address the squad’s shortage of attacking midfielders.

The transfer is being closely watched as Sparta seeks to reinforce its lineup for the upcoming season.
